Cranberry Pumpkin Bread

This is a great breakfast bread to be served for the Thanksgiving and Christmas holidays.

Ingredients
- 3 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
- 3 cups sugar
- 4 tsp. pumpkin pie spice
- 2 tsp. baking soda
- 1 tsp. salt
- 4 eggs
- 1 can (15-oz.) solid pack pumpkin
- 1/2 cup vegetable oil
- 2 cups fresh or frozen cranberries, thawed
- 1 cup chopped walnuts

Preparation
Step 1
Preheat oven to 350.
In a large bowl, combine flour, sugar, pumpkin pie spice, baking soda and salt. In another bowl, beat the eggs, pumpkin and oil;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in the cranberries and walnuts.
Spoon into 2 greased loaf pans. Bake at 350 for 70 -80 minutes or until a toothpick inserted near the center com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es before removing from pans to wire racks to cool completely.
